The Mechanics of The Box Plot Enigma: Solved - Calculating The Interquartile Range (Iqr) In 5 Steps
At its core, The Box Plot Enigma: Solved - Calculating The Interquartile Range (Iqr) In 5 Steps revolves around the calculation of the Interquartile Range (IQR). But what exactly is IQR, and how is it calculated? Simply put, IQR is the difference between the third quartile (Q3) and the first quartile (Q1). To calculate Q1 and Q3, data is sorted in ascending order, and the middle values are identified.
Calculating the Interquartile Range (Iqr) in 5 Easy Steps
Now that we have a basic understanding of IQR, let's dive into the step-by-step process of calculating it. Here's how you can do it in 5 simple steps:
1. Sort the data in ascending order.
2. Identify the first quartile (Q1) as the median of the lower half of the data.
3. Identify the third quartile (Q3) as the median of the upper half of the data.
4. Calculate the Interquartile Range (IQR) by subtracting Q1 from Q3 (IQR = Q3 - Q1).
